1 Reader Writer Locks pseudocode
2 ==============================
3
4 pthread_rwlock_rdlock(pthread_rwlock_t *rwlock);
5 pthread_rwlock_unlock(pthread_rwlock_t *rwlock);
6 pthread_rwlock_wrlock(pthread_rwlock_t *rwlock);
7
8 struct pthread_rwlock_t {
9
10 unsigned int lock:
11 - internal mutex
12
13 unsigned int writers_preferred;
14 - locking mode: 0 recursive, readers preferred
15 1 nonrecursive, writers preferred
16
17 unsigned int readers;
18 - number of read-only references various threads have
19
20 pthread_t writer;
21 - descriptor of the writer or 0
22
23 unsigned int readers_wakeup;
24 - 'all readers should wake up' futex.
25
26 unsigned int writer_wakeup;
27 - 'one writer should wake up' futex.
28
29 unsigned int nr_readers_queued;
30 - number of readers queued up.
31
32 unsigned int nr_writers_queued;
33 - number of writers queued up.
34 }
35
36 pthread_rwlock_rdlock(pthread_rwlock_t *rwlock)
37 {
38 lll_lock(rwlock->lock);
39 for (;;) {
40 if (!rwlock->writer && (!rwlock->nr_writers_queued ||
41 !rwlock->writers_preferred))
42 break;
43
44 rwlock->nr_readers_queued++;
45 val = rwlock->readers_wakeup;
46 lll_unlock(rwlock->lock);
47
48 futex_wait(&rwlock->readers_wakeup, val)
49
50 lll_lock(rwlock->lock);
51 rwlock->nr_readers_queued--;
52 }
53 rwlock->readers++;
54 lll_unlock(rwlock->lock);
55 }
56
57 pthread_rwlock_tryrdlock(pthread_rwlock_t *rwlock)
58 {
59 int result = EBUSY;
60 lll_lock(rwlock->lock);
61 if (!rwlock->writer && (!rwlock->nr_writers_queued ||
62 !rwlock->writers_preferred))
63 rwlock->readers++;
64 lll_unlock(rwlock->lock);
65 return result;
66 }
67
68 pthread_rwlock_wrlock(pthread_rwlock_t *rwlock)
69 {
70 lll_lock(rwlock->lock);
71 for (;;) {
72 if (!rwlock->writer && !rwlock->readers)
73 break;
74
75 rwlock->nr_writers_queued++;
76 val = rwlock->writer_wakeup;
77 lll_unlock(rwlock->lock);
78
79 futex_wait(&rwlock->writer_wakeup, val);
80
81 lll_lock(rwlock->lock);
82 rwlock->nr_writers_queued--;
83 }
84 rwlock->writer = pthread_self();
85 lll_unlock(rwlock->lock);
86 }
87
88 pthread_rwlock_unlock(pthread_rwlock_t *rwlock)
89 {
90 lll_lock(rwlock->lock);
91
92 if (rwlock->writer)
93 rwlock->writer = 0;
94 else
95 rwlock->readers--;
96
97 if (!rwlock->readers) {
98 if (rwlock->nr_writers_queued) {
99 ++rwlock->writer_wakeup;
100 lll_unlock(rwlock->lock);
101 futex_wake(&rwlock->writer_wakeup, 1);
102 return;
103 } else
104 if (rwlock->nr_readers_queued) {
105 ++rwlock->readers_wakeup;
106 lll_unlock(rwlock->lock);
107 futex_wake(&rwlock->readers_wakeup, MAX_INT);
108 return;
109 }
110 }
111
112 lll_unlock(rwlock->lock);
113 }
